This study empirically tests the impacts of equity structure on strategic investment psychology in green affairs in R&D vs. Marketing dimensions and company performance. Based on data from Chinese high-tech industry listed companies, the empirical results show that: (1) the largest shareholder’s shareholding ratio has a positive effect on marketing investment psychology and a negative impact on R&D investment psychology, (2) other large shareholders’ shareholding ratio are positive related to R&D investment psychology; (3) R&D investment psychology has a negative effect and marketing investment psychology has a positive influence on the current performance; (4) equity counterbalance is positive related to R&D investment psychology and has a negative effect on the current performance. This study contributes to the literature of corporate governance on sustainability issue by providing a new psychological perspective. The results also provide an important guidance for the corporate governance practice in green economies.

The place of Ukraine's territory and its military-economic potential in the accumulation in the European region of a large number of troops, naval forces, military equipment and armaments, powerful enterprises, institutions and organizations of defense purposes, which have a negative impact on the environment are determined; �ontaminated and continues to be contaminated the main components of the environment: soil, surface and groundwater, atmosphere air. The basic principles of internal policy in the field of national security and defense are indicated. The transition of the military-industrial complex and the Armed Forces of Ukraine to the "green" model of development is substantiated. The role of the military-industrial complex in the environmental pollution is proved. It is shown that the domestic defense industry has some scientific, technical and production capabilities to create competitive armament and military equipment, but significantly behind in the implementation of environmental standards and ecology-oriented technology and is not a leader in the new global transition to the "green" economy and the "green" growth. It is proved that in the course of reforming the military-industrial complex, its reconversion, the destruction of outdated ammunition, wastes of military production and military products, and in the event of non-compliance with environmental requirements, should expect the deterioration of the ecological state of the territory. Considered the main innovational directions, which provide an increase of the degree of ecologization of the military economy and form a technological "green" jump in the specified sphere of activity: introduction of alternative types of energy into the activities of defense enterprises and army units; creation of weapons based on "green" technologies, using of "smart" clothing. Substantiated the prospects of further researches, which consists in defining the goals, objectives, principles, directions and approaches of ecologization of the military-industrial complex and the Armed Forces of Ukraine, assessment and classification of eco-friendly technologies, development of high-tech competitive industries, rational re-engineering of the military-industrial complex, development of mechanisms and tools for the ecologically oriented development and transition to the "green" technological model.

Leading world countries view innovative development and high-tech business as an opportunity to overcome economic stagnation and decline in economic growth. One of the modern trends in the analysis of high-tech development is the study of high-tech knowledge-intensive service industries and their development in times of crisis. The purpose of the paper is to identify patterns of development of large, medium and small enterprises in high-tech service industries in Russia during periods of crisis. Economic and economic-mathematical methods of analysis are applied to the formed samples of enterprises. The research period is 2013-2017. The financial indicators of enterprises were adjusted for the level of accumulated inflation in relation to 2013. According to results, large and medium-sized enterprises showed insignificant or weak significant positive dynamics of revenue during all years of the crisis period. The crisis period did not lead to a decrease in the revenue of these groups of enterprises. The acute phase of the crisis (2014-2015) had a pronounced negative impact on the group of small enterprises in all studied industries, but they successfully recovered in 2016-2017 and reached the pre-crisis level of revenue. The total revenue by industries and groups of enterprises in 2017 became higher than in 2013, and its growth rates were significant for many groups of enterprises, which indicates a successful overcoming of the crisis period and signs of growth in high-tech service industries. Our study shows the need for state support for small businesses in high-tech service industries in crisis conditions, and identifies the possibilities of adaptation of enterprises in these industries to an unfavorable external environment. Our results may be useful for the purposes of government stimulation of economic development in the current environment.

E.P. Meinecke, a noted plant pathologist and staunch supporter of conservation, authored an influential article about the impacts of tourism on redwood trees. In the Effect of Excessive Tourist Travel on the California Redwood Parks, published in 1929, Meinecke found that soil compaction by tourists had a negative impact on tree roots and his recommendations for amelioration were both logical and laced with philosophical ideals. We revisit that report with a modern perspective by reviewing his findings and suggestions, and by comparing his ideas with modern research and tourism management practices. One of Meinecke’s greatest concerns was the advent of the automobile and its ability to bring more people to redwood groves. We take that concern to the next logical step and discuss potential impacts of climate change on redwood trees.

AbstractThis research quantitatively and qualitatively analyzes the factors responsible for the water level variations in Lake Toba, North Sumatra Province, Indonesia. According to several studies carried out from 1993 to 2020, changes in the water level were associated with climate variability, climate change, and human activities. Furthermore, these studies stated that reduced rainfall during the rainy season due to the El Niño Southern Oscillation (ENSO) and the continuous increase in the maximum and average temperatures were some of the effects of climate change in the Lake Toba catchment area. Additionally, human interventions such as industrial activities, population growth, and damage to the surrounding environment of the Lake Toba watershed had significant impacts in terms of decreasing the water level. However, these studies were unable to determine the factor that had the most significant effect, although studies on other lakes worldwide have shown these factors are the main causes of fluctuations or decreases in water levels. A simulation study of Lake Toba's water balance showed the possibility of having a water surplus until the mid-twenty-first century. The input discharge was predicted to be greater than the output; therefore, Lake Toba could be optimized without affecting the future water level. However, the climate projections depicted a different situation, with scenarios predicting the possibility of extreme climate anomalies, demonstrating drier climatic conditions in the future. This review concludes that it is necessary to conduct an in-depth, comprehensive, and systematic study to identify the most dominant factor among the three that is causing the decrease in the Lake Toba water level and to describe the future projected water level.
